Polyamine Coagulant for Food Processing Wastewater DAF Pretreatment
Product Overview
Meat and poultry wastewater varies sharply between production, washdown and sanitation periods. Blood, protein, tissue fines, fat and detergents create a complex DAF feed. Polyamine can improve initial charge neutralization, while a selected PAM increases floc size and bubble capture.
Designed for pretreatment after effective screening and free-fat control. It does not disinfect wastewater or replace biological treatment for dissolved organic load.

Recommended Treatment Approach
Separate coarse solids at the source and equalize wastewater where feasible. Run tests on production and sanitation samples because detergent carryover can change coagulation. Dose polyamine first, then add PAM at lower shear and evaluate actual DAF flotation.
Dosage Optimization
Optimize for TSS, FOG, COD, float solids and chemical cost. Include sludge dewatering behavior because a program that removes more solids but creates watery float may raise total disposal cost.
Handling and Storage
Use corrosion-compatible metering equipment and prevent contamination between chemical tanks. If dilution is required, add product to clean water with moderate agitation and verify solution stability before continuous use. Keep containers sealed and follow the grade-specific SDS and TDS for personal protection, storage temperature and spill response.
